Ultimate Guide: Choosing the Perfect Debian Desktop Environment


Ultimate Guide: Choosing the Perfect Debian Desktop Environment.

Debian Desktop Environment

Debian, known for its stability and vast software repository, presents a captivating range of desktop environments (DEs) tailored to various user preferences and system requirements.

This guide showcases the best Debian desktop environments and thoroughly analyzes each available option.

1. KDE Plasma

KDE Plasma is the ultimate choice for users who crave a luxurious and highly customizable desktop experience. With its sleek design and plethora of advanced features, this desktop environment allows users to tailor every aspect of their workspace to their liking. From personalized themes and widgets to powerful tools for organizing and managing files, KDE Plasma offers a level of customization that is unmatched by any other desktop environment. Whether you are a power user looking to optimize your workflow or simply someone who appreciates the finer details of design, KDE Plasma is sure to impress with its opulent and feature-rich environment.


Unparalleled Customization: KDE Plasma empowers users to personalize their desktops to an exceptional degree, ensuring a truly individual experience.

Feature Powerhouse: A vast array of functionalities and features are readily available within KDE Plasma, catering to diverse user needs.

Wayland Support: Like GNOME, KDE Plasma embraces Wayland, offering improved graphics rendering and security.


Resource Demands: KDE Plasma’s extensive features can be resource-intensive, potentially impacting performance on older hardware.

Customization Complexity: The sheer volume of customization options might overwhelm new users, requiring a steeper learning curve.

2. Xfce

Xfce emerges as the champion when efficiency and speed take center stage.

This lightweight DE prioritizes minimal resource consumption, making it ideal for users with older hardware or those aiming for a streamlined desktop experience.

Despite its resource-conscious nature, Xfce boasts a user-friendly interface and offers a wide range of available applications.


Efficiency Champion: Xfce excels in resource efficiency, ensuring smooth performance even on older machines.

Ideal for Older Hardware: Its lightweight nature makes Xfce perfectly suited for revitalizing older computers, extending their lifespan.

User-Friendly Interface: Despite its lightweight design, Xfce provides a user-friendly and intuitive interface.


Feature Sparsity: Compared to other DEs, Xfce might lack some advanced features, catering to a more basic workflow.

Visual Simplicity: While functional, Xfce’s visual appeal might not be as modern or customizable as some other options.


GNOME’s customization options allow users to personalize their desktop environment to suit their preferences, whether it’s changing the theme, adding extensions, or rearranging the layout of the desktop. This flexibility ensures that users can create a workspace that is both visually appealing and functional for their needs.

One of the key features of GNOME is its integration with online accounts, allowing users to easily access and manage their emails, calendars, and files from various online services directly from the desktop. This seamless integration streamlines workflow and enhances productivity for users who rely on online services for their daily tasks.


Effortless Learning Curve: GNOME’s intuitive design facilitates a smooth learning curve for new users.

Extensive Software Ecosystem: A vast array of applications seamlessly integrates with GNOME, ensuring efficient workflow management.

Wayland Support: GNOME embraces Wayland, a next-generation display server, offering smoother graphics rendering and enhanced security.


Resource-Intensity: GNOME’s feature-rich nature might translate to higher resource consumption, potentially impacting older hardware performance.

Minimalist Appeal: Some users might find the interface’s minimalism lacking in visual customization options.


For users yearning for a familiar and traditional desktop experience, MATE presents a compelling solution.

This DE is a continuation of the GNOME 2 codebase, offering a comfortable and reliable environment for users accustomed to GNOME 2 or seeking stability.


Familiar Interface: MATE’s traditional interface provides a sense of familiarity for users accustomed to older GNOME versions.

Lightweight and Stable: Built on a mature codebase, MATE prioritizes stability and resource efficiency, ensuring reliable performance.

Ideal for GNOME 2 Users: Users familiar with GNOME 2 will find a seamless transition to the similar layout and workflow of MATE.


Limited Modern Features: MATE might not offer the latest features and functionalities available in contemporary DEs.

Outdated Visual Style: The visual theme of MATE might feel outdated for users seeking a more modern aesthetic.

5. Cinnamon

Cinnamon carves its niche by striking a balance between modern features and a traditional desktop experience.

Originally a GNOME 3 fork, Cinnamon preserves traditional desktop elements such as a menu bar and panels while incorporating contemporary features and boasting a visually appealing design.


User-Friendly with Familiarity: Cinnamon bridges the gap between modern features and familiar desktop elements, facilitating a smooth transition for new users.

Visually Appealing Design: Cinnamon boasts a modern and visually appealing design, catering to users who prioritize aesthetics.

Resource Efficiency: Compared to heavier DEs like KDE Plasma, Cinnamon demonstrates improved resource efficiency, offering a balance between features and performance.


Resource Consumption: Compared to lightweight alternatives like Xfce and LXQt, Cinnamon has slightly higher resource demands.

While not as resource-intensive as KDE Plasma, it might not be the most suitable choice for older or low-powered machines.

Customization Options: While offering a decent degree of customization, Cinnamon’s options might not be as extensive as those provided by KDE Plasma.

Users seeking granular control over every aspect of their desktop environment might find Cinnamon’s customization capabilities limiting.

Potential Performance Issues: Although generally performing well, Cinnamon might exhibit occasional performance hiccups, especially on resource-constrained systems.

This is because it strikes a balance between lightweight design and visual effects, which can lead to trade-offs in certain scenarios.


Explore More; Complete Walkthrough: Installing Nvidia Drivers on Linux